A US Marine Corps (USMC) rifle detail from Marine Corps Base (MCB) Hawaii, Kaneohe, Hawaii (HI), fire a 21-gun salute with 5.56 mm M16A2 rifles during a ceremony dedicating a new flagstaff and display of bronze plaques commemorating the 73 Marines who gave their lives and the 15 survivors of the attack on the US Navy (USN) battleship USS ARIZONA at Pearl Harbor, HI, on December 7, 1941. The memorial features the names of the 88 Marines stationed aboard ARIZONA during the attack, a piece of steam pipe from the ARIZONA's original hull, the National ENSIGN, and the US Navy and Marine Corps flags
